Default Lake Constance-South Germany

is the next Scooby meeting.
A big party will be held at Subaru Autohaus "Sailer" on the 22.of July

Nearly all Club's in Germany have announced there coming (including the Brit's community )

Hope we can get to see more Subi's from the UK!!

For further info in English: Lake Constance
